Question

I bought a laptop about a month ago and today at 6pm Service Pack 3 was
installed.I immediately got a blue screen after the instalation and every
time I boot up I get the blue screen after a minute making the laptop
unusable.The hard drive is 93% free.
The screen read :
STOP : 0x0000007E, 0xB6A8A8E723, 0x BAD0F614, 0x BAD0F310
Mtlmnt5.sys Add:B6A8E723, base at B6A7E000 DATESTAMP 42078541

Now the blue screen reads:
0x0000007E (0x0000005, 0xB1FOF723, xBADOF614, 0xBADOF310
Mtlmats.sys Address B1FOF723 base at B1EFF000 DATESTAMP 42078541

Can anyone please help? I have had blue screens before but they never
crippled the computer.Is SP3 to blame?

ps, computer is XP Pro, 3.66GHz, 2GB RAM & 2GB HD.It has only been in use
the past 5 days! Thanks!
pps, I have no spyware, malware or virus on the computer.

Stop 7E - System Thread Exception Not Handled
The base address indicates system space. May or may not be non-paged pool.

Discussed in KB330182.

Mtlmnt5.sys - A modem or softmodem driver from Microsoft
The base address indicates system space. May or not be non-paged pool.
Can't find much about this driver.
